Output 156fce00136b3dba08e01681d0384e0f9db4ebc7e21d5e053eefd67edafab3da:35
- value
- 25598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7dd65e5141f68919bdbd111876b00689b1a25d3d OP_EQUAL
- address
- 3DAPC6sRFC8avQHsadrjgaonSiRdZT6Qo7
- transaction
- 156fce00136b3dba08e01681d0384e0f9db4ebc7e21d5e053eefd67edafab3da
- confirmations
- 26185
- spent
- true